What are common causes of airbag sensor circuit issues?

Airbag sensor problems can have different causes that affect car safety.

Bad wiring is common and happens due to wear or wrong setup, leading to weak or broken connections. Moisture can cause connectors to rust, blocking the signals needed for airbags to work.

Sometimes, the sensors have factory flaws, which might need a recall or fix. If a car gets hit but the airbags don't go off, the sensors might get moved or broken, stopping them from working right.

Additionally, software bugs in the airbag control system can mess up sensor readings and stop airbags from deploying.

How can you diagnose an airbag sensor circuit problem?

To find problems with an airbag sensor circuit, follow these steps:

1. Use a Scanner: Connect an OBD-II scanner to your car to get any error codes related to the airbag system.

2. Look at the Wiring: Check the connectors and wires for any damage or wear.

Make sure all connections are tight and secure.

3. Test the Circuit: Perform tests to check if the circuit is complete and if the resistance is at the right level.

4. Check the Manual: Read your car's service manual for specific steps related to troubleshooting the airbag system.

5. Clear and Test Again: After making repairs, clear the error codes and test the system again to ensure everything works correctly.

What tools are needed to troubleshoot airbag sensor circuit issues?

To troubleshoot airbag sensor circuit problems, you'll need a few key tools.

Here's what you'll use:

  • Diagnostic Scan Tool: This tool reads error codes from your car's system. It helps you find out what's wrong with the airbag sensors.
  • Multimeter: With this, you can check voltage, resistance, and if the circuit is connected properly. It's useful for finding electrical issues.
  • Oscilloscope: This tool lets you see the electrical signals in the circuit. It helps find any unusual patterns that could cause problems.

These tools help you check and fix any issues with the airbag sensors to keep your car safe.

How much does it typically cost to repair an airbag sensor circuit?

Fixing an airbag sensor circuit can cost between $150 and $600. The price depends on the car's make and model, the problem's nature, and the service provider's labor rates.

Luxury cars might cost more due to complex systems and special parts. Labor can be a big part of the cost, especially if detailed checks are needed.

If new parts are required, their brand and availability can affect the price. A certified technician should handle the repair for safety reasons, even if it costs more.
